Australia coal on the rise despite banks walking away
Thu, Aug 13, 2015 - 5:50 AM
Australia's coal exports are forecast to rise this year to 202.9 million tonnes, second only to Indonesia and nearly twice that of Russia, government data shows.
PHOTO: BLOOMBERG
Sydney
STANDARD Chartered has become the second bank in a week to walk away from a multi-billion dollar Australian coal project, leading environmentalists to claim a major victory in one of the world's top coal-producing nations.
